CVE-2019-14930 2 Inea, Mitsubishielectric 4 Me-rtu, Me-rtu Firmware, Smartrtu and 1 more 2024-11-21 10.0 HIGH 9.8 CRITICAL
An issue was discovered on Mitsubishi Electric Europe B.V. ME-RTU devices through 2.02 and INEA ME-RTU devices through 3.0. Undocumented hard-coded user passwords for root, ineaadmin, mitsadmin, and maint could allow an attacker to gain unauthorised access to the RTU. (Also, the accounts ineaadmin and mitsadmin are able to escalate privileges to root without supplying a password due to insecure entries in /etc/sudoers on the RTU.)
CVE-2019-14926 2 Inea, Mitsubishielectric 4 Me-rtu, Me-rtu Firmware, Smartrtu and 1 more 2024-11-21 7.5 HIGH 9.8 CRITICAL
An issue was discovered on Mitsubishi Electric Europe B.V. ME-RTU devices through 2.02 and INEA ME-RTU devices through 3.0. Hard-coded SSH keys allow an attacker to gain unauthorised access or disclose encrypted data on the RTU due to the keys not being regenerated on initial installation or with firmware updates. In other words, these devices use private-key values in /etc/ssh/ssh_host_rsa_key, /etc/ssh/ssh_host_ecdsa_key, and /etc/ssh/ssh_host_dsa_key files that are publicly available from the vendor web sites.

CVE-2019-14482 1 Adremsoft 1 Netcrunch 2024-11-21 10.0 HIGH 9.8 CRITICAL
AdRem NetCrunch 10.6.0.4587 has a hardcoded SSL private key vulnerability in the NetCrunch web client. The same hardcoded SSL private key is used across different customers' installations when no other SSL certificate is installed, which allows remote attackers to defeat cryptographic protection mechanisms by leveraging knowledge of this key from another installation.

CVE-2019-13352 1 Wolfvision 1 Cynap 2024-11-21 10.0 HIGH 9.8 CRITICAL
WolfVision Cynap before 1.30j uses a static, hard-coded cryptographic secret for generating support PINs for the 'forgot password' feature. By knowing this static secret and the corresponding algorithm for calculating support PINs, an attacker can reset the ADMIN password and thus gain remote access.
